Visit London’s Severine Ougier competes in Flora London Marathon

Severine Ougier

Visit London Business Marketing Manager Severine Ougier is aiming to raise £1,500 for the Multiple Sclerosis Trust by running this year's Flora London Marathon.

Sunday 26 April will be Ougier's first marathon. Training began in the French Alps over Christmas and she has been working hard ever since to prepare for the 26.2 mile race. In 1995, Ougier's dad was diagnosed with Multiple Sclerosis. She said: "As a fairly stubborn "mountain goat", and despite some partial paralysis, my dad has for the last few years been working towards achieving his life-time dream – re-building a 100-year old house in the French Alps, most of it on his own. A colossal project, which for a former architect is, I guess, the pinnacle of a life-long dream. Running a marathon was never one of my dreams. But after seeing those around me achieve their dreams despite physical impairments, and seeing what other people do to support them, I have decided it's my turn to act."
